Casa Colombo is a retro-chic hotel that blends a contemporary designer style with the charms of a magnificent 200 year-old Moorish mansion. Built by one of the wealthiest Indian trading families at the time, the mansion is adorned with acres of Italian and Indian mosaic floors, carved arches, moulded ceilings and Moorish styled balconies, and is one of the few remaining treasures of its era.
The property is located in the heart of Colombo’s business district. However it is neatly cosseted away from the busy Galle Road by its own cul de sac and is a gated and very private hotel.

The property, although boutique, also offers three fabulous eateries: HVN is located in the grand hall of the mansion and is a stylish restaurant with gold carved ceilings, an antique fan that spans 18 feet, organza glass tables and a fresco of local god’s meditating in the clouds. The menu features an eclectic fusion of local Cuisine and Flavors prepared by renowned chefs and the food and atmosphere is nothing less than heavenly. Za Za is an outdoor restaurant surrounded by water and overlooks the magnificent façade of the mansion. Decorated with egg-shaped chairs and cracked glass tables, this outdoor eaterie offers a relaxed dining experience that brings together local flavours and global lounge music to create an epicurean dining experience. T Republic is yet another airy outdoor venue and is located on the lawn facing the front façade of the mansion. For the ultimate dining experience you could also opt to enjoy a private dining experience at Champagne and Sky, a very special location at the very top of the building.
Probably the first Pink Pool in the world, the poolside is a delight for the senses. It has 8 glass sun beds, 3 canopied day beds and chrome elephants wading the shallow pool. The day beds come complete with two music selectors and headphones and a telephone for each.
